British aerial bombs were among the basic armament of Royal Air Force bomber and attack aircraft during World War II. The RAF used a wide range of bomb types - from light fragmentation and incendiary bombs to heavy demolition bombs designed to destroy fortified targets, industrial sites and infrastructure. Each type had a specific design, weight and method of use appropriate to the task - for example, General Purpose (GP) bombs for general purpose use, High Capacity (HC) bombs with a thin wall and large charge for maximum pressure wave, or special incendiary bombs for attacking cities and warehouses. These weapons formed the backbone of the British bombing campaign over Europe and were deployed on virtually every battlefield where the RAF operated.
